Faculty note: Prof. Morgan has new publication

UW-Green Bay Associate Prof. Eric J. Morgan (Democracy and Justice Studies and History) has a chapter featured in Four Dead in Ohio: The Global Legacy of Youth Activism and State Repression, edited by Johanna A. Solomon and recently published by Emerald Insight. Morgan’s chapter, “To Thread the Conscience: Michigan State University and the Anti-Apartheid Movement,” examines the campaigns of students and educators at MSU who participated in the contentious debate over divestment, whether to engage with the South African government and apartheid through dialogue and communication or to disengage completely from the country through withdrawal of the university’s financial investments. Four Dead in Ohio is the 45th volume in the Research in Social Movements, Conflicts, and Change series.
